Welcome to the Ministry!
The five of us, veteran writers all, started this publication in the summer of 2024 because of an absence we were feeling as readers. Where could we go to get robust, heartfelt, thoughtful writing on popular culture? Newspapers and magazines keep shrinking their cultural coverage, and we realized it was time to create our own space.
We decided to launch Ministry of Pop Culture as a place where readers could come to engage with the movies, shows, books, and music that mattered to them most. We want to provide our audience with the kind of in-depth, personal coverage of culture that they couldn’t get elsewhere. With our mix of exclusive interviews, behind-the-scenes coverage, sharp analysis of work we admire (or despise!), and personal essays, we want to remind readers why we all love culture so much, and create a space to gather and share the love. When you read Ministry of Pop Culture, you will hopefully learn something you never knew before, or be reminded of a feeling you could never put the words to before, or both.
